Republican governors of border states in the USA are competing to outdo one another in acts of odd cruelty – now by chartering buses and planes to bring asylum seekers to northern, Democratic states or to the District of Columbia, as if to say, how do you like them apples!

Evidently inspired by a clever suggestion of the preppy television reactionary, Tucker Carlson, Florida’s erstwhile preppy Navy judge advocate and current governor, Ron DeSantis, is celebrating the latest delivery of a group of Venezuelans to Martha’s Vineyard, Massachusetts (a state whose governor, alas, is also a Republican).

As one might expect, the citizens of this rich holiday island are treating the arrivals well, and telling anyone who asks just how well. In the past day or so, church groups, firemen, student translators, and the director of a homeless shelter have told reporters how far they have gone out of their way to help so as to show Mr DeSantis a few apples of their own.

What do Venezuelans think? Leaving aside for a moment the recently trafficked, whose opinions do not seem to matter to anyone, Talleyrand went to interview a few actual Venezuelans back in the governor’s home state, who, presumably, do matter in his upcoming bid for re-election:

— María Luz C., age 43. Hurrah for the governor! He shows the world how terrible the dictator Maduro is by drawing attention to the plight of our people. More sanctions for Maduro!

— Ignacio M., age 22. This is very unfair. I spent three months in a hot detention centre. I want a free holiday to this vineyard.

— Roberto Y., age 34. We are insulted. Venezuelans in Florida are kind and hospitable. We can take care of our own.

— Valeria M., age 15.  I hate politicians.

— Enrique T., age 63. I have nothing to say. I am Cuban.
